Non-banks not allowed to load credit lines on prepaid wallets, or cards.

RBI has asked fintech to stop this practice immediately. The change will come into effect on July 1.

Some fintech is in tie-up with banks to offer credit. Slice, Uni, Fi, PayU's LazyPay, etc. extend credit through prepaid co-branded cards.

RBI said, "The PPI-MD does not permit loading of PPIs from credit lines. Such practice, if followed, should be stopped immediately

According to the RBI, prepaid payment instruments (PPIs) are payment instruments, which facilitate the buying of goods and services
